Questions & Answers

What companies run services between Bodrum, Muğla, Turkey and Baku, Azerbaijan?

AJet, Pegasus Airlines, and Turkish Airlines fly from Milas–Bodrum Airport (BJV) to Heydar Aliyev International Airport (GYD) every 4 hours.
